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 13 Oct 2023 13:41:48 +0200
From:      Baptiste Daroussin <bapt@freebsd.org>
To:        Oliver Lehmann <oliver@freebsd.org>
Cc:        Alexey Dokuchaev <danfe@freebsd.org>, ports-committers@freebsd.org,  dev-commits-ports-all@freebsd.org, dev-commits-ports-main@freebsd.org
Subject:   Re: git: 97d52f6d4735 - main - */*: Set an expiration date for several Worldforge libraries and schedule for removal - There has been no release for most of the libraries in the past 10 years.
Message-ID:  <6eerl24jwxveqvubprpe5hghk4v3xjfqhymwoxfgkwjzelzic7@sm2m7koledme>
In-Reply-To: <20231013113806.Horde.kQ2v4Cct4l8wkc-cTB1ZRDX@avocado.salatschuessel.net>
References:  <202310121741.39CHfwg4021895@gitrepo.freebsd.org> <ZSiytgigvFMKavE3@FreeBSD.org> <20231013113806.Horde.kQ2v4Cct4l8wkc-cTB1ZRDX@avocado.salatschuessel.net>

next in thread | previous in thread | raw e-mail | index | archive | help
On Fri, Oct 13, 2023 at 11:38:06AM +0000, Oliver Lehmann wrote:
> Hi Alexey,
> 
> Alexey Dokuchaev <danfe@freebsd.org> wrote:
> 
> > On Thu, Oct 12, 2023 at 05:41:58PM +0000, Oliver Lehmann wrote:
> > > commit 97d52f6d473533d6d53e5771c0839c160a2b92dd
> > > 
> > >   Set an expiration date for several Worldforge libraries and schedule
> > >   for removal - There has been no release for most of the libraries in
> > >   the past 10 years.
> > > ...
> > 
> > Looking at https://github.com/worldforge, their repos are well alive and
> > receiving updates.  Maybe we could ask them to tag releases more often
> > rather than removing (presumably working) ports?
> > 
> > ./danfe
> 
> While this might be true, most - if not all of the libs - are rather
> useless if none of worldforges main products like their game client
> Ember is not ported. It was ported once but got removed from the ports
> tree years ago - I fail to remember what was the issue back then.
> So while those libs could be kept there, they are not much of a use
> without any real using component anyway.
> If you still think its useful to keep them I can revert this commit
> and hand them over to ports@ because I don't intend to maintain them
> anymore. I don't see a real worlds benefit in doing so.
> We have no usage statistics of those ports of course but I doubt that
> anyone is using them - because what would they use them for and it
> shouldn't be in the ports system just to have it. It should serve a
> purpose.

No this commit should not be revert, the deprecation is a good way to notify
whoever is interested in maintaining those because they find it useful, if noone
step up, then it will be removed, which is not a big deal, it is easy to revive
if needed.

Bapt



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?6eerl24jwxveqvubprpe5hghk4v3xjfqhymwoxfgkwjzelzic7>